1

Eclipse IDEを使用して(Windows 7を使用して)最初のC++実行可能ファイルを作成しようとしています。ビルド中に次のエラーが発生します。

それを修正する方法は?

エラー::メインスレッドのコンテキストを取得できませんでした、エラー998

情報:構成「デバッグ」は、このシステムでサポートされていないツールチェーン「CygwinGCC 」を使用しており、とにかくビルドしようとしています。

すべて作る

'ビルドファイル:../ src / LestTest.cpp' [sig] C:\ cygnus \ cygwin-b20 \ H-i586-cygwin32 \ bin \ make.exe 1000(0)call_handler:メインスレッドのコンテキストを取得できませんでした、エラー998

バッシュ

ここに画像の説明を入力してください

パス環境変数には次のものがあります

C:\ cygwin \ bin \

Eclipseの次のスクリーンショットをご覧ください

ここに画像の説明を入力してください

ここに画像の説明を入力してください

ここに画像の説明を入力してください

ここに画像の説明を入力してください

4

2 に答える 2

3

まず第一に、あなたはCygwinをインストールしているように見えますが、それは古いバージョンのようです。お持ちのバージョンをアンインストールし、ここからセットアッププログラムをダウンロードして、現在のバージョンをインストールすることをお勧めします。インストールするg++を必ず選択してください。

更新:考え直してみると、Cygwinを使用するための特定の要件がない場合は、代わりにMinGWを使用する方が簡単な場合があります。インストール手順はこちらです。

于 2012-08-05T16:11:14.153 に答える
0

エラーで説明されているように「Bash」でテストを行います:プログラム「make」がPATHに見つかりません

Bashの結果がCygwinで言及されている場所を指していることを確認してください

コードをビルドします-これにより、バイナリフォルダーが作成されます

アプリケーションを実行する

于 2012-08-11T05:32:00.863 に答える